Description

Also known as Gui Zhi or Dai Lu, is a mid-season variety. It flowers from late March to late April, with slender flower branches and a flowering period of about 25 to 30 days. The fruit matures and is available from late June to early July.

Gui Wei lychee is renowned for its excellent quality, featuring a small seed, crisp and juicy flesh, sweet flavor, and a hint of osmanthus fragrance. It is the most durable lychee variety in terms of storage and transport. The fruit retains its bright red skin and flavor for several days after harvest. The fruit is round or nearly round, medium-sized, with an average weight of about 17 grams. The skin is pale red, thin, and crisp, while the flesh is milky white. The edible portion makes up 78-83% of the total fruit weight. It has a soluble solids content of 18-21%, vitamin C content of 29.48 milligrams per 100 milliliters of juice, and acidity of 0.21 grams. The seeds can be either normally developed (large seed) or degenerated (shrunken seed). Gui Wei lychee is known for its excellent hanging capability, with fruit remaining on the tree for over ten days after maturity without falling off, maintaining its sweetness and flavor with minimal impact on quality during harvesting.
